New countactless pick-up program to launch at THE AVENUE in White Marsh

Posted
and last updated

WHITE MARSH, Md. — Federal Realty announced a new contactless pickup program that set to start at all of its shopping centers, including THE AVENUE at White Marsh.

Branded "The Pick-Up," the program is made available to all tenants and customers looking for comfortable ways to return to shopping.

It expands on an already curbside pick-up program that began at the start of the COVID-19 mandatory closings. Customers will be able to place orders directly with stores by phone or online and arrange for same day pick up.

"When our customers arrive, they will simply notify us with a quick call or text and our team can run their order out to their car, with a completely countactless exchange," said Bill Blocher, owner of Red Brick Station and Brew Pub and Ando's Market, which is located at THE AVENUE. "Federal is helping us meet a new demand with this program and given us a tool we need to thrive in a challenging environment."

Federal plans to expand this service, in response to the changes in customer shopping habits.

"We see this as a long-term solution to finding even more convenient ways for customers to shop," said Emily Gagliardi, Director of Leasing.

Look for "The Pick-Up" at other Federal properties in Baltimore County, including White Marsh Plaza and The Shoppes at Nottingham Square.
